New Delhi, Jan 15 (UNI) India’s labour market indicators showed continued improvement in December 2025, with labour force participation and workforce levels rising to their highest levels of the year, while the overall unemployment rate remained broadly stable. The figures came as per the latest Monthly Bulletin of the Periodic Labour Force Survey (PLFS) released by the National Statistical Office (NSO) under the Ministry of Statistics and Programme Implementation (MoSPI).
